what is the chemical formula of rust?

The chemical formula for rust is Fe2O3.nH2O.
Rust is the reddish brittle coating formed on iron especially when chemically attacked by moist air and composed essentially of hydrated ferric dioxide.

Fe(OH)3 dehydrates to produce Fe2O3.nH2O
Rust consists of hydrated iron oxides,iron oxides-hydroxide. It is the common term for corossion of iron and it's alloys.
